How He Earns from Boxing Matches

Eric Molina’s professional boxing career began in 2007, and he has since faced some of the sport’s biggest names. His earnings are tied to high-profile matches, including bouts with Anthony Joshua and Deontay Wilder.

His victory against Tomasz Adamek for the NABF heavyweight title and participation in WBC and IBF title fights significantly boosted his earnings.

Fight Records and Their Impact on His Career

Molina’s fight record reflects a mix of triumphs and challenges. Notable wins like those against Tomasz Adamek and Rodricka Ray enhanced his reputation, while losses to Anthony Joshua and Deontay Wilder exposed him to a global audience, indirectly contributing to his financial growth.
